Payback period in capital budgeting refers to the time required to recoup the funds expended in an investment, or to reach the break-even point. [1]For example, a $1000 investment made at the start of year 1 which returned $500 at the end of year 1 and year 2 respectively would have a two-year payback period.

A capital recovery factor is the ratio of a constant annuity to the present value of receiving that annuity for a given length of time. Using an interest rate i , the capital recovery factor is: C R F = i ( 1 + i ) n ( 1 + i ) n − 1 {\displaystyle CRF={\frac {i(1+i)^{n}}{(1+i)^{n}-1}}}
